Available Programs
We've barely started and already have a fine start on important programs:
- classes in bicycle maintenance and repair; bicycle safety presentations and training (outreach to K-12 schools, youth organizations, businesses, other public and private organizations)
- providing training and mentoring of youth in bicycle safety, etiquette, and maintenance
- partnership with Boys and Girls Clubs of Central Iowa cycling program to share access to shop and equipment
- outreach clinics to YMCA adult residents and Homes of Oakridge youth and families to tune up bicycles and provide information and education about bicycle maintenance and safe riding
- partnership with Iowa Bureau of Refugee Services to provide bicycles for international refugees in Des Moines to use for transportation
- The Collective organized Bike Iowa Month for the Des Moines area (May 2010)
- The Collective is raising funds to hire a program director to do outreach and provide programs for businesses, schools, churches, local/county/state government, and civic organizations
